Spiced Stuffed Squid Recipe

Ingredients

  • 3 Squid (cleaned)
  • 1 cup Water
  • 1/2 cup white wine
  • 1/2 cup Uncooked white rice
  • 1/4 cup Pine nuts
  • 1/4 cup Raisins
  • 2 tbl. Olive oil
  • 3 tsp. Anchovy paste
  • 2 tsp. Red pepper flakes (crushed)
  • 2 tsp. Oregano (dried)
  • 7 Garlic cloves (crushed)
  • 1 Onion (chopped)
  • 14 1/2 oz. Tomatoes (stewed)

Method

  1. Pour the water and rice into a large saucepan.
  2. Place over a medium heat and cook for about 20 minutes.
  3. Cut the tentacles and head from the squid. Then chop the tentacles up.
  4. remove the quill and then peel off the skin.
  5. Rinse off the prepared squid under cold water and set aside.
  6. Now combine the rice, with the pine nuts and raisins.
  7. Heat a large skillet with a little oil and sauté 4 of the garlic cloves until soft.
  8. Then stir in the red pepper flakes and dried oregano.
  9. pour in the tomatoes, their juice, wine and the anchovy paste.
  10. Season the mixture to taste and cook over a medium heat.
  11. Now stuff the squid with the mixture and secure with a wooden toothpick.
  12. Place the stuffed squid on a greased baking tray.
  13. Bake in an oven preheated to 350° for an hour.
  14. Garnish with lemon wedges and serve hot.
